Excel引用ERP数据技巧,如何快速实现数据同步?
1、Excel可以通过多种方式引用ERP数据,包括直接导入、API接口、数据库连接和第三方插件。2、以简道云ERP系统为例,其支持数据导出与API对接,极大提升了数据同步效率。3、利用API连接可实现实时或准实时的数据交互,便于企业进行动态分析与报表制作。4、选择最适合企业业务流程的集成方式至关重要。
《excel如何引用erp数据》
以“利用API连接可实现实时或准实时的数据交互”为例,许多现代ERP如简道云ERP系统提供开放的API接口,用户可以通过Excel Power Query等工具,将ERP中的关键数据直接拉取到Excel中进行处理。这种方式不仅避免了手工导入的繁琐,还能确保数据的一致性和时效性,特别适合对数据更新要求较高的业务场景。
一、EXCEL引用ERP数据的核心方法
企业在日常经营管理中,常常需要将ERP(Enterprise Resource Planning)系统中的业务数据引入到Excel进行进一步分析与报表制作。实现这一目标主要有以下几种方法:
| 方法 | 简介 | 适用场景 | 难易程度 |
|---|---|---|---|
| 1. 数据导出/导入 | ERP系统导出CSV/Excel文件后再导入Excel | 数据量不大、不需频繁同步 | ★☆☆☆☆ |
| 2. ODBC/JDBC直连 | Excel通过ODBC/JDBC访问数据库 | 有数据库权限且技术能力较强 | ★★★★☆ |
| 3. API接口集成 | 利用RESTful API + Excel Power Query等工具拉取/推送数据 | 实现自动化和定期刷新 | ★★★★☆ |
| 4. 第三方插件/中间件 | 使用专用插件或RPA工具连接ERP和Excel | 对接复杂系统或定制需求 | ★★★☆☆ |
这些方法各有优劣,需要根据实际需求与现有IT条件选择合适方案。
二、API接口集成——实现高效自动化
现代化ERP如简道云ERP系统(官网:https://s.fanruan.com/2r29p )往往提供开放的API接口,支持多种主流的数据交互标准。这为企业用Excel引用实时ERP数据提供了极大便利。
操作步骤示例(以简道云为例)
- 获取API文档:登陆简道云后台,在开发者中心获得相关API文档说明,包括认证方式、请求参数及返回格式。
- 配置Token或认证信息:按照平台要求设置访问密钥(Token)、账号密码或OAuth等认证。
- Power Query中编写请求:打开Excel → 数据 → 获取数据 → 来自Web,输入相应的API Endpoint,并在高级选项里填写Headers。
- 解析返回结果:通常会获得JSON格式的数据,可在Power Query编辑器内进一步清洗和格式化。
- 设置刷新规则:可设定每次打开文件或按计划自动刷新,实现准实时同步。
优势详解
- 效率提升:避免人工反复操作,只需初次配置即可持续自动获取最新业务数据。
- 灵活性强:可筛选所需字段,自定义查询逻辑,更好地支持个性化分析需求。
- 安全合规:通过受控开放接口,不暴露底层数据库权限,有利于IT安全管控。
三、ODBC直连与传统导出法对比
除了API集成外,还有两种常见对接方式,即ODBC数据库直连和传统的数据导出/导入法。
对比表格
| 对接方式 | 优势 | 劣势 |
|---|---|---|
| ODBC/JDBC直连 | 高度自动化,可实现SQL级别自定义查询 | 配置复杂,对权限与网络环境依赖较大 |
| 导出/导入 | 操作简单,无需额外技术支持 | 手动操作频繁,不适合实时动态需求 |
背景说明
对于部分老旧或封闭性的ERP系统,其不一定拥有完善的开放API。这时,通过ODBC直连其后台数据库是一条路,但需IT人员具备SQL能力,同时要确保网络与安全策略允许远程访问;而最基础的“先从系统里手工导出,再到Excel里打开”,虽然普遍存在,但效率低下且容易造成版本混乱,仅适用于小规模临时性操作。
四、多步骤实操指南(以Power Query+简道云为例)
以下以简道云ERP为代表,详细讲解如何在实际工作中配置Excel引用其业务数据:
步骤一:准备工作
- 获取企业在简道云注册账户,并开通对应模块权限;
- 管理员进入开发者中心生成专属Token/API密钥;
- 明确所需查询的数据表及字段名;
步骤二:搭建连接
- 在Excel顶部菜单选择“获取数据”→“来自其他源”→“来自Web”;
- 输入简道云指定的RESTful API地址,如:https://api.jdy.com/open_api/v1/data/list
- 在弹出的高级设置内添加Header(如Authorization: Bearer {Token});
- 点击连接后,根据返回内容结构调整字段映射;
步骤三:清洗与建模
- 利用Power Query界面完成字段筛选、多表关联等动作;
- 可以建立参数化查询,比如只拉当天或本周订单;
步骤四:结果输出及定期刷新
- 将整理后的结果直接加载进新工作表;
- 设置刷新周期,让报表随时保持最新状态;
五、安全合规及常见问题答疑
为了保证企业敏感信息不泄露,同时防止因误操作导致风险,需要关注如下方面:
- 严格分配访问权限,只授予必要人员调用接口权利;
- 定期更换Token密钥,并监控接口调用日志;
- 避免将完整敏感数据库暴露给所有终端,应只输出分析所需精要字段;
- 注意防护SQL注入等风险,如使用ODBC/JDBC时应限制执行权限仅限SELECT语句;
常见问题举例
-
Q: 如果不会写代码怎么办? A: 可让IT同事协助首次设定,大多数现代工具如Power Query界面友好,也支持拖拽式配置。
-
Q: ERP升级后链接失效? A: 检查新版本是否更改了接口地址或认证机制,如有变动及时修改对应参数即可恢复正常同步。
六、典型案例分析与应用场景推荐
实际应用中,不同行业和部门针对“把ERP引到Excel”的诉求各异。例如:
- 财务部门利用同步销售订单明细,每日自动生成收入分析报表;
- 仓储部门拉取库存明细,实现库存预警看板动态更新;
- HR部门汇总员工绩效考核结果,用于年度评价统计;
案例说明(以销售订单分析为例):某制造型企业采用简道云作为主力信息平台,通过上述API+Power Query方案,实现销售主管每天早上打开电脑即可看到最新全渠道订单分布,无须再手动整理大量原始文件,大幅提升了管理效率并减少人为差错率。
七、新一代SaaS ERP(如简道云)的优势特征
随着SaaS模式兴起,新型轻量级平台如简道云普遍具备如下特征:
- 无需本地部署硬件,一键开通即用;
- 丰富自定义模板库,可灵活扩展业务场景;
- 支持无代码/低代码开发,普通员工即可搭建流程和自定义报表接口;
- 完善开放平台文档体系,为第三方集成提供便利支撑;
这使得即便是没有专业研发团队的小微企业,也能快速打通“从业务到决策”的最后一公里壁垒,让数字资产真正服务于管理创新。
八、总结建议及行动指引
综上所述,将excel引用erp数据已成为数字化办公的重要组成部分。尤其是像简道云这样的新一代轻量级SaaS ERP,无论是通过简单的数据文件导出还是高级的API集成,都能满足不同规模、不同行业客户的多样诉求。如果你追求高效率、高安全和高扩展性的解决方案,建议优先考虑基于开放平台+Power Query或者专业插件实现自动同步。同时,要重视账号权限分配和操作日志追溯,以保障全流程的信息安全。
对于尚未开展此类集成实践的公司,可以优先安排内部试点,比如财务部或仓库部,以“小切口”逐步推广经验,再根据具体成果优化整体数字化转型路径——最终让每个员工都能享受到智能办公带来的价值红利!
最后推荐: 分享一个我们公司在用的ERP系统的模板,需要可自取,可直接使用,也可以自定义编辑修改:https://s.fanruan.com/2r29p
精品问答:
Excel如何高效引用ERP数据?
我最近在做财务报表,需要将ERP系统中的数据导入到Excel中进行分析。但是我不太清楚有哪些高效的方法可以实现Excel引用ERP数据,避免手动复制粘贴。有什么推荐的技巧吗?
要高效地在Excel中引用ERP数据,常用的方法包括:
- 使用ODBC连接:通过配置ODBC数据源,Excel可以直接连接ERP数据库,实现实时数据更新。
- 利用Power Query:Power Query支持多种数据源连接,可以轻松导入和转换ERP系统中的数据。
- 导出CSV/Excel文件:部分ERP系统支持导出功能,导出后可通过Excel进行二次处理。
案例说明:例如,某企业利用Power Query连接SAP ERP数据库,每周自动刷新销售报表,实现了报表生成时间缩短50%。
根据CIO调研数据显示,70%的企业采用Power Query工具提高了ERP数据的使用效率。
如何确保Excel引用的ERP数据实时同步?
我在用Excel引用ERP系统的数据时,发现有时候数据更新不及时,这让我担心分析结果的准确性。有没有方法能保证Excel中的ERP数据是实时同步的?
确保Excel中引用的ERP数据实时同步,可以采用以下技术手段:
- 使用动态连接(如ODBC或OLE DB):配置后,能够直接访问数据库最新状态。
- 利用Microsoft Power BI或Power Query自动刷新功能,设置定时刷新频率。
- 部署VBA宏实现自动拉取最新的数据。
例如,通过配置ODBC连接并设置每小时刷新一次,使得销售团队能第一时间获取最新订单信息。根据调研,有85%的企业采用动态连接技术提高了数据实时性。
在Excel中引用ERP数据时如何处理大规模数据性能问题?
我的公司ERP系统里的历史交易记录非常庞大,当我在Excel里引用这些大量的数据时,经常出现卡顿甚至崩溃。有什么优化策略能提升性能吗?
针对大规模ERP数据在Excel中的性能问题,可以采取以下措施:
- 数据筛选与分批加载:只加载必要字段与时间段的数据,减少内存占用。
- 使用Power Pivot建立内存模型,提高计算效率。
- 避免复杂公式和过多的数据透视表操作。
- 利用数据库视图或存储过程预处理并简化查询结果。
案例:某制造企业通过拆分年度销售记录,并运用Power Pivot模型,实现了报表响应速度提升40%。
如何保证通过Excel引用的ERP数据显示安全和权限控制?
我担心直接从Excel访问和引用ERP系统中的敏感业务数据会带来安全风险,比如权限泄露或者未授权访问,有什么办法能保障安全性?
保障通过Excel引用的ERP数据显示安全性,可以采取如下措施:
- 实施基于角色的访问控制(RBAC),确保用户只能访问授权范围内的数据。
- 利用加密连接(如SSL/TLS)保护传输过程中的敏感信息。
- 配置数据库层面的权限管理,例如只允许读取特定视图或表的数据。
- 审计日志监控用户访问行为,及时发现异常操作。
例如,一家金融机构采用多层权限控制策略,实现了对敏感客户信息的严格保护,同时支持业务人员利用Excel灵活分析非敏感指标。
文章版权归"
转载请注明出处:https://www.jiandaoyun.com/nblog/108080/
温馨提示:文章由AI大模型生成,如有侵权,联系 mumuerchuan@gmail.com
删除。